What Happened With Nicki Minaj on ‘American Idol’? Her Feud With Mariah Carey & More
The feud involved a leaked fight video and allegations of threats, resurfacing after Minaj’s political support, with Minaj earning $12 million for her single season as judge.
- Recently, Nicki Minaj and Mariah Carey’s American Idol feud resurfaced after Minaj's public support of Donald Trump and TMZ's leaked video from October 2012 reignited interest.
- The Season 12 judging panel featured Randy Jackson, Keith Urban, Nicki Minaj, and Mariah Carey and aired January 16, 2013 to May 16, 2013 after auditions filmed in fall 2012.
- A dispute during auditions involved a contestant, with Nicki Minaj calling Mariah Carey `boring as f**k` and Carey asking `Do I have a 3-year-old sitting around me?`, with producers not airing the full fight.
- Minaj confirmed her departure two weeks after the finale, ending her one-season stint; Mariah Carey and Randy Jackson also left, with Forbes reporting Minaj earned $12 million for judging.
- On The View, Carey alleged Minaj said `If I had a gun, I would shoot her`, which Minaj disputed on X, noting no camera or mic heard the comment and saying she would not `plead the fifth` about the incident.
